Port News Critique of Carthagena Expedition Demand

A letter to the Daily Post questions Britain’s policy toward France and the Carthagena expedition. It argues for a firmer stand against France, critiques the Gazette, and lists five pointed queries about strategic decisions and the timing of attacks. The piece also notes various naval movements and arrivals in deal and Bristol.

Royal George Ready to Sail Next Week as Repairs Complete

Reports from Portsmouth state the Royal George of Sir John Norris’s squadron is out of the dock after mast damage and leaks, fully repaired and prepared to sail next week. London also notes Treasury appointment of William Williams as Receiver-General for South Wales, plus various local events and an attack on a Peckham gentleman by two footpads in North-Field.

Newgate Prisoner Linked to Surrey Theft and Local Fraud

Forenoon scene shows several men at a distance who stole money and fled toward the Halfway House to Deptford. William Rogers is captured and imprisoned in the New-Gaol, Southwark, for stealing a 25 ell piece of linen from Mr Selby of Carshalton. The Callicoe printers and local tradespeople endure similar felonies as the gang is uncovered, with efforts to bring them to justice. Trade imports and exports are listed, including 2630 lb thrown silk, 30 tuns oil, 40 C. juniper berries, 5 tuns wine, 93 tons iron, and various goods to Holland, Dublin, Carolina, and Antigua. High water at London Bridge noted as 39 minutes after 7 in the afternoon.

Pay Office Pension Notice for Royal Navy Widows 1741

Notice to widows of Commission and Warrant Officers in the Royal Navy that pensions and bounty will be paid. Dates span late May 1741 with specific days for Captains, Lieutenants, masters, and other ranks. London and Paris residents must appear in person or provide church minister attestation to receive funds.

Bank of England Clerk John Waite Missing With Bonds

Notice of John Waite once at the Bank of England who vanished on May 13 and is believed to have taken East India Bonds of considerable value. Warrants issued for his apprehension. Reward offered by the Governor and Company totaling five hundred pounds for safe capture and delivery to law.
